A Nearpod B Kahoot C TEOD Prezi 28 A teacher who wants to learn online teaching is expected to arrive by A9:00 am B10:30 am C2:00 pm D3:30 pm C If youre planning on travelling,there are a few simple rules about how to make life easier both before and after your journey. First of all ,always check and double-check departure (起程) time. It is amazing how few people really do this carefully. Once I arrived at the airport a few minutes after ten. My secretary had got the ticket for me and I thought she had said that the plane left at 10:50. When I arrived at the airport, the clerk at the departure desk told me that my flight was closed. Therefore, I had to wait three hours for the next one and missed an important meeting. The second rule is to remember that even in this age of credit cards, it is still important to have at least a little of the local currency(货币) with you when you arrive in a country. This can be necessary if you are flying to a place few tourists normally visit. Once I arrived at a place at midnight and the bank at the airport was closed. The only way to get to my hotel was by taxi and because I had no dollars, I offered to pay in pounds instead. “Listen! I only take real money!” the driver said angrily. Luckily I was able to borrow a few dollars from a clerk at the hotel, but it was embarrassing. The third and last rule is to find out as much as you can about the weather at your destination(目的地) before you leave. I feel sorry for some of my workmates who travel in heavy suits and raincoats in May, when it is still fairly cool in London or Manchester, to places like Athens, Rome or Madrid, where it is already beginning to get quite warm during the day. 29 Where is the writer most probably from? Do you have trouble focusing in class? Do you feel like complaining? If so, you might not be getting enough sleep. On weekday mornings, Vanessa Louie, 10, is pulled out of bed by her mother. Some days, she watches a little bit of TV. Vanessa gets about eight hours of sleep each night. Shes not alone. Studies show that kids across the nation arent catching enough sleep. Jodi Mindell, a sleep expert says children aged 5 to 12 should get 10 to 11 hours of sleep each night. But according to a survey by the National Sleep Foundation, kids only sleep an average of nine and a half hours a night. An extra 30 minutes of nap may not seem like a lot, but it can make a huge difference to kids. Research shows that the amount of sleep you get can affect how well you learn. Students who are well rested tend to score higher on math and writing tests. Meanwhile, kids who get less sleep have a harder time paying attention in class, which can affect future test performance. Lack of(缺乏) sleep can also affect your coordination (协调),behavior and mood. “Youre more likely to be bad- tempered if you dont get a good nights rest,” says Jodi Mindell. “Sleep affects everything.” What s keeping kids up at night? One big sleep stealer is the use of electronics, says Mindell. More kids are online, playing video games, texting friends and watching TV before bed. “Using electronics keeps your brain stimulated, ” Mindell explains. “It s a lot of bright light to your eyes at a time when your body needs dim light to help you feel sleepy. ” “It s never too late to change your sleep habits , ” Mindell says. Make sleep a priority (首要事情) . Keep the same sleep schedule (时间表) every day. Pull the plug (插头) on electronics in the bedroom. Turn off the lights, and go to sleep early for a week. “Then see how you feel, ” Mindell says. “You will be surprised at the difference.” 33 What can we learn from the passage about Vanessa?
